What is AWS?
AWS (Amazon Web Services) is a vast, evolving cloud computing platform provided by Amazon that includes a combination of platform-as-a-service (PaaS), infrastructure-as-a-service (IaaS), and packaged-software-as-a-service (SaaS) offerings. AWS services can offer communities tools such as database storage, compute power, and content delivery services.
The Amazon Web Services (AWS) platform provides over 200 fully featured services from data centres worldwide and is the worlds world’s most comprehensive cloud platform.
AWS is an online platform that provides cost-effective cloud computing solutions.
AWS is an extensively adopted cloud platform that offers several on-demand processes, like compute power, database storage, content delivery, etc., to help corporates scale and grow.
How Does it Work?
That was all about what Amazon Web Services is. Next, let’s have a watch at the history.
History of AWS
- In the year 2002 – launched AWS services
- In the year 2006- Launched AWS cloud products
- In the year 2012 – AWS had its first client event
- In the year 2015- AWS earned $4.6 billion
- In the year 2016- Beat the $10 billion revenue target
- In the year 2016- AW Service snowball and AWS snowmobile were launched
- In the year 2019- Cast approximately 100 cloud services
Moving forward, we will learn more about Amazon Web services.
How Does AWS Work?
AWS (Amazon Web Services) usually works in several other configurations depending on the user’s requirements. Yet, the user must be able to see the type of configuration utilized and the particular server map concerning the AWS service.
Advantages of AWS
- AWS provides a user-friendly programming model, architecture, database, and operating system already known to employers.
- AWS is a very cost-effective service. There is no such thing as a long-term commitment to anything you would like to purchase.
- It offers billing and management for the centralized sector, hybrid computing, and fast installation or removal of your application in any location with a few clicks.
- There is no need to pay extra money to run data servers by AWS.
- AWS offers a total ownership cost at very reasonable rates compared to other private cloud servers.
Disadvantages of AWS
- AWS has supporting paid packages for intensive or quick response. Thus, users might require to pay extra money for that.
- There might be some cloud computing issues in AWS, especially when you move to a cloud Server, such as backup security, downtime, and some limited control.
- From region to region, Amazon Web Services sets some defaulting limitations on resources such as volumes, pictures, or snapshots.
- If there is a sudden change in your hardware system, the application on the cloud might offer poor performance.
Migration
Migration services use three different sub-services, DMS, SMS, and snowball, to physically transfer data from Datacenter to AWS.
- DMS (Database Migration Service) migrates one database to another.
- SMS is a Server Migration Service that helps to migrate on-site servers to AWS within a short period.
- Snowball migrates data inside terabytes to data outside the Amazon Web Services environment.
Applications of Amazon Web Services
The most common applications of Amazon Web Services are depository and Backup, websites, gaming, mobile, web, and social media applications.
Pricing Model of AWS
AWS’s pricing model is very cost-effective, which makes it the most reliable. For instance, if a user desires to use a cloud server for an hour, AW Services asks the user to pay only for an hour.
There is no such long-term commitment as five or ten years and pay accordingly. Besides, there is an AWS free tier service to increase the potential customer’s affordability by offering free assistance with AWS servers and up to 58 products that help users gain some experience with the AWS platform.
AWS Services
Amazon has many services for cloud applications. Let us list a few critical benefits of the AWS ecosystem and briefly describe how developers use them in their business.
Amazon has a list of services:
- Compute service
- Storage
- Database
- Networking and delivery of content
- Security tools
- Developer tools
- Management tools
Conclusion
In this introductory tutorial, “what is AWS”, we discussed what cloud computing is, what AWS is and its history, and we also went through all the AWS services.
Whether you’re an experienced Amazon Web Services Architect or aspiring to break into this exciting industry, registering in our Cloud Architect Training program will help individuals with all levels of experience master AWS Cloud Architect strategies.